China’s potential restrictions on open-source AI development reflect a strategic tension between its global outreach and domestic control objectives. While the Chinese Communist Party (CCP) has promoted low-cost, open-source AI models as part of its Belt and Road-style initiatives to developing nations ◉ edexlive.com · 1, internal fears about security risks are driving stricter oversight. Reports indicate that Beijing’s concern extends beyond traditional cyber threats to include the potential misuse of AI for generating politically destabilizing content, such as deepfakes or data-poisoned narratives that could challenge official state narratives ◉ thehansindia.com · 5. This duality—exporting open-source tools while tightening domestic controls—highlights the CCP’s prioritization of information sovereignty over unrestricted technological collaboration.
The proposed restrictions could reshape global AI ecosystems by creating regulatory fragmentation. For instance, China’s potential export controls on advanced models like Alibaba’s Qwen or Zidai AI’s GLM-5.2 may force developers to navigate tiered compliance frameworks, increasing costs and complexity ◉ geeky-gadgets.com · 6. Meanwhile, the CCP’s emphasis on “national security” risks stifling innovation by limiting access to open-source tools that many developers rely on for experimentation and education. This aligns with broader trends of tech nationalism, where states prioritize strategic autonomy over global interoperability, as seen in recent U.S. and EU efforts to restrict AI exports ◉ time.com · 7.
Domestically, China’s approach underscores a paradox: while Xi Jinping has framed AI as a “global public good” internationally, developers within the country face stringent censorship that blocks access to critical global resources ◉ theepochtimes.com · 3. This contradiction raises questions about the feasibility of China’s open-source outreach, as its own researchers may lack the tools to contribute meaningfully to international AI advancements. Furthermore, the CCP’s focus on controlling AI’s “training data” and content generation mechanisms suggests a long-term strategy to shape the ethical and operational norms of AI, potentially diverging from Western frameworks ◉ justsecurity.org · 2.
China’s concerns about open-source AI extend beyond traditional cybersecurity threats to include risks of systemic exploitation. Party officials have expressed alarm that advanced AI could be weaponized for large-scale scams, terrorism, or even the creation of bioweapons, as noted in a New York Times report cited by src-1. This fear is compounded by the inherent nature of open-source models, which can be downloaded, modified, and deployed without oversight—potentially allowing malicious actors to bypass censorship mechanisms. For instance, src-5 highlights warnings from Chinese experts about AI-driven deepfakes and data-poisoning techniques that could generate content challenging official narratives, such as fabricated evidence of social unrest or human rights violations.
The modifiability of open-source AI models also raises commercial and ethical risks for global developers. Unlike closed systems, which enforce strict access controls, open-source frameworks enable unrestricted redistribution and adaptation, increasing the likelihood of unintended misuse. src-1 underscores this vulnerability, noting that safety protections can be stripped away, leaving models susceptible to exploitation for phishing campaigns, automated disinformation, or even autonomous cyberattacks. These risks have prompted discussions about tiered export controls, as seen in src-6’s analysis of China’s potential restrictions on models like Alibaba’s Qwen, which could force developers to navigate fragmented compliance regimes while balancing innovation against security concerns.
